Sharpening by hand

If the knife is not very dull, it is enough to touch up the edges with a flat file.

  • First remove the rust (if any) with a wire cloth or brush.
  • Don't go for a razor-sharp edge - remove the rounds and burrs.
  • Try to maintain the original sharpening angle and sharpen both blades evenly. Otherwise, an imbalance will appear, and the blade will “walk” from side to side. As a result - rapid wear of bearings and replacement of the engine.

To check the balance, you need to hang the knife by threading a pencil or nail through the central hole. Next, we look to see if one of the sides outweighs. If so, then the heavier side still needs to be filed.

An unbalanced blade vibrates during operation, and vibrations not only impair the comfort and safety of the lawn mower, but also abuse the machine and shorten its life. Rotary lawn mowers

The most common lawn mowers are rotary, they are the best-selling. But they all have an identical design, two sharp knives are placed in the body (or deck). They rotate at high speed, creating an air current that lifts the grass, and the blades cut it evenly. With the same air flow, the cut grass is sent to a specially built-in bag (grass collector). To make the air flow stronger, the knives are made in the form of blades, they are driven at high speed by an electric or gasoline engine.

Proper sharpening of lawn mower blades

The knife has a crescent shape, cuts off, and does not cut grass. For the formation beautiful lawn it is important that the grass is evenly cut, but not pulled out of the ground, so the knife must be well sharpened. It is best to grind it on a grinding stand, but you can also use a regular drill with a grinding attachment for grinding. To do this, be sure to turn off the motor and remove the knife, then loosen the bolt at the fastening point and separate the knife. If the knife has screwed blades, then you just need to turn the blades. Next, evaluate the condition of the blunt blades, they can be bent from the impact of stones, in which case they are straightened with a hammer. A knife made from a single piece of metal requires only the corners to be sanded.
It should be borne in mind that the metal must be removed in the same layer on both sides, otherwise the knife may become unbalanced and this may lead to failure of the lawn mower. Sharpening lawn mower blades requires the obligatory observance and control of the balance of both blades of the knife. It is best to use the time axis - put a knife on it, then it will be seen whether the knife sits evenly and it will be possible to control the uniformity of sharpening. If one side is heavier, it should be sharpened and balanced.
